Significant Life Change Story
My nickname is Beam. I am 18 years old, currently in Grade6, studying Chinese language at a school in Pai Province. I live with my father and mother and my older sister. I want to thank you the Lord for giving me the opportunity to be part of the Saturday School program since i was in Grade1. At that time, I had just moved from Chaiyaphum province, and I didn’t know anyone. I was shy and awkward, but every week, I had the chance to participate in activities and play with the other kids who came here. From being strangers, we became friends. It’s amazing how, in just a few days, I’ll be finishing Grade 6. Time really flies, and next year, I’ll be heading to university.
I am grateful to the Lord for bring me here, giving me the chance to participate in activities and receive guidance in planning for my future education. Since Grade 3, the Light Center (Saturday school) has invited various speakers to share to us, providing advice and inspiration. After that, older students who were part of the Saturday School program would come and offer advice on choosing a major, creating a portfolio for university applications, financial planning, applying for scholarships and more. The school also recommended scholarship opportunities from various organizations or foundation to help ease the financial burden for students.
One thing that impressed me was the availability of counselling and assistance, and the Lord has prepared everything for me. I am now able to pass the university entrance exam and have been accepted into Maejo University, majoring in Agricultural Production, Faculty of Agriculture, under the Bachelor of Science program. I would like to thank you Operation Blessing Foundation (Thai) for supporting such beneficial activities for kids like me in Pai Province. Without the Saturday School program, I might no have received guidance on how to plan for my future. I am grateful to everyone who has supported and prayed for me. Thank you all.
